Caring for Your microTALK
Your microTALK
radio will give you years of trouble-free service

if cared for properly. Handle the radio gently. Keep the radio away from
dust. Never put the radio in water or in a damp place. Avoid exposure to
extreme temperatures.

Use only the supplied rechargeable batteries and charger for recharging
your Cobra microTALK
Cobra recommends your radio is turned off while being charged.
Non-rechargeable alkaline batteries can also be used in your radio.
